The video tutorial introduces algebraic equations, focusing on the 'story of X' to solve equations. It explains how to describe operations on X and solve equations by reversing these operations. Three examples are provided: solving X + 7 = 18, 4X = 28, and 5X + 1 = 21. Each example demonstrates the process of building the equation, solving it, and verifying the solution.
